Once printing begins, the Centauri Carbon’s CoreXY motion system takes over. It’s genuinely thrilling to see the gantry zip across at speeds up to 500 mm/s with accelerations reaching 20,000 mm/s²—numbers you’d normally associate with industrial machines rather than a desktop unit. Whether you are rushing to prototype a mechanical part or simply experimenting with elaborate architectural models, this speed doesn’t come at the expense of precision. In fact, thanks to the printer’s pressure advance feature and automatic vibration compensation, you end up with crisp details and virtually no ringing, even on the most intricate contours.
One of the most compelling aspects of the Centauri Carbon is its ability to tame advanced materials. The all-metal hotend—capable of reaching 320 °C—is paired with a brass-hardened steel nozzle, which handles abrasive carbon- and glass-fiber–reinforced filaments like a champ. Imagine designing lightweight drone frames, high-strength prosthetic prototypes, or heat-resistant automotive components right from your studio. At the same time, the dual-sided build plate, with a PLA-specific textured side and a PEI-coated side for tougher materials, ensures consistent adhesion and near-zero warping across a broad spectrum of filaments.
Stability is another cornerstone of this machine. Elegoo’s choice of an integrated die-cast aluminum frame isn’t just for show. The solid chassis absorbs the energy of those record-breaking print speeds, so your prints come out smooth and accurate. Paired with a hot bed that heats up to 110 °C, you get reliable layer bonding and fewer failed prints—even when you’re running long, all-night sessions.
Yet what really sets Centauri Carbon apart is how it keeps you connected to your work. The enclosed metal-and-glass chamber provides a controlled environment for temperature-sensitive filaments, while the built-in chamber camera acts as an extra pair of eyes. With live streaming and time-lapse recording, you can step away from the printer, confident that you’ll catch any issues early or share your progress with clients and colleagues in real time.
On the user-interface front, the 4.3-inch capacitive touchscreen feels intuitive and responsive—no more wrestling with clunky menus or cryptic button presses. Connectivity options include both USB and Wi-Fi, and with over-the-air firmware upgrades, your machine stays current with the latest performance tweaks and new features. You can prepare prints in Elegoo’s own slicer, Orca, or your favorite software like Cura, then export your models in STL, OBJ, 3MF, or STP formats and send them straight to the printer in G-code.
